Kolkata Knight Riders Part Ways with Head Coach Chandrakant Pandit

Kolkata Knight Riders have parted ways with head coach Chandrakant Pandit after three seasons. Pandit joined the team in August 2022, following Brendon McCullum's appointment as England Men's Test head coach.

Under Pandit's leadership, KKR won the trophy in 2024, led by Shreyas Iyer, after a decade-long wait. The franchise thanked Pandit for his contributions, including the 2024 championship win and building a strong squad.

Pandit's record with KKR includes 22 wins and 18 losses in 42 games across three seasons. However, the team finished eighth in the 2025 season, winning only five of their 14 league outings.

KKR is yet to announce a replacement for Pandit.
